Tips for Leveraging the “Hotels Near Me Super 8” Search Query
These tips provide actionable strategies for businesses seeking to attract travelers using the “hotels near me Super 8” search query. Focusing on local search engine optimization (SEO) and online reputation management will maximize visibility and conversion rates.
Tip 1: Claim and Optimize Google Business Profile: Ensure the business’s Google Business Profile is claimed, verified, and up-to-date. Accurate address, phone number, and operating hours are crucial for local search results.
Tip 2: Implement Local SEO Best Practices: Utilize location-based keywords throughout the website content, meta descriptions, and image alt tags. This increases visibility in local searches.
Tip 3: Manage Online Reviews: Actively monitor and respond to online reviews on platforms like Google, TripAdvisor, and Yelp. Addressing both positive and negative feedback builds trust and credibility.
Tip 4: Ensure Mobile-Friendliness: A mobile-responsive website is crucial for capturing on-the-go travelers using mobile devices to search for nearby accommodations.
Tip 5: Highlight Amenities and Services: Clearly communicate amenities relevant to budget-conscious travelers, such as free Wi-Fi, breakfast, and parking. Emphasize value and convenience.
Tip 6: Monitor Competitor Strategies: Analyze competitors’ online presence, pricing strategies, and guest reviews to identify opportunities for differentiation and improvement.
Tip 7: Utilize Location-Based Advertising: Consider location-based advertising campaigns on platforms like Google Ads to target users searching for hotels in specific geographic areas.
By implementing these strategies, businesses can effectively target travelers searching for nearby accommodations and maximize their online visibility. A strong online presence and positive reputation are essential for converting these searches into bookings.

- Page Load Speed
Mobile users expect fast loading times. Slow page load speeds can deter potential guests, especially those seeking immediate accommodations. Optimizing images, minimizing HTTP requests, and leveraging browser caching contributes to faster loading times, enhancing user experience and improving search engine ranking. A traveler searching “hotels near me Super 8” on a mobile device with limited bandwidth expects a website that loads quickly. Delays can lead to abandonment and selection of a competitor’s site.
- Local SEO
Local search engine optimization (SEO) practices are crucial for mobile visibility. Accurate location data, cons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one number) information, and mobile-specific keywords contribute to higher rankings in local search results. A traveler searching for a nearby Super 8 relies on accurate location data and consistent business information across various online platforms. Discrepancies can lead to confusion and distrust.
- Mobile-First Indexing
Search engines prioritize the mobile version of a website for indexing and ranking. This underscores the importance of a mobile-optimized website for overall search visibility. A business prioritizing its mobile website ensures its content is readily accessible and indexed by search engines, maximizing visibility for mobile users seeking accommodations like a Super 8.
